diff options
author | Michael D Kinney <michael.d.kinney@intel.com> | 2020-06-10 17:36:38 -0700 |
---|---|---|
committer | mergify[bot] <37929162+mergify[bot]@users.noreply.github.com> | 2020-07-15 05:25:21 +0000 |
commit | 77e42ca4dfbf51918d677f32ab64bb99dd07cc40 (patch) | |
tree | c0b6cf2ab9dcc44a8745475310d43a6058c415f2 /BaseTools/Source/Python/AutoGen/UniClassObject.py | |
parent | 813c2b15255406f587484ffcedfd01ca9ab5d056 (diff) | |
download | edk2-77e42ca4dfbf51918d677f32ab64bb99dd07cc40.tar.gz edk2-77e42ca4dfbf51918d677f32ab64bb99dd07cc40.tar.bz2 edk2-77e42ca4dfbf51918d677f32ab64bb99dd07cc40.zip |
UnitTestFrameworkPkg/UnitTestLib: Move print log into cleanup
REF: https://bugzilla.tianocore.org/show_bug.cgi?id=2805
If a unit test fails with an exception or an assert, then the
CmockaUnitTestFunctionRunner() is terminated and the logic
that follows the invocation of the unit test is skipped. This
currently skips the logic that prints log messages.
Move the print of log messages to the end of the function
CmockaUnitTestTeardownFunctionRunner() that is guaranteed to
be executed when a unit test completes normally or is
terminated with an exception or an assert.
Cc: Sean Brogan <sean.brogan@microsoft.com>
Cc: Bret Barkelew <Bret.Barkelew@microsoft.com>
Cc: Jiewen Yao <jiewen.yao@intel.com>
Signed-off-by: Michael D Kinney <michael.d.kinney@intel.com>
Reviewed-by: Liming Gao <liming.gao@intel.com>
Reviewed-by: Bret Barkelew <Bret.Barkelew@microsoft.com>
Diffstat (limited to 'BaseTools/Source/Python/AutoGen/UniClassObject.py')
0 files changed, 0 insertions, 0 deletions